# -*- encoding: utf-8 -*- # stub: rtanque 0.1.2 ruby lib Gem::Specification.new do |s| s.name = "rtanque".freeze s.version = "0.1.2".freeze s.required_rubygems_version = Gem::Requirement.new(">= 0".freeze) if s.respond_to? :required_rubygems_version= s.require_paths = ["lib".freeze] s.authors = ["Adam Williams".freeze] s.date = "2014-01-27" s.description = "RTanque is a game for programmers. Players program the brain of a tank and then send their tank+brain into battle with other tanks. All tanks are otherwise equal.\n\nRules of the game are simple: Last bot standing wins. Gameplay is also pretty simple. Each tank has a base, turret and radar, each of which rotate independently. The base moves the tank, the turret has a gun mounted to it which can fire at other tanks, and the radar detects other tanks in its field of vision.\n\nHave fun competing against friends' tanks or the sample ones included. Maybe you'll start a small league at your local Ruby meetup.".freeze s.email = ["pwnfactory@gmail.com".freeze] s.executables = ["rtanque".freeze] s.files = [".gitignore".freeze, ".rspec".freeze, ".ruby-gemset".freeze, ".ruby-version".freeze, ".travis.yml".freeze, ".yardopts".freeze, "Gemfile".freeze, "Gemfile.ci".freeze, "LICENSE.txt".freeze, "README.md".freeze, "Rakefile".freeze, "bin/rtanque".freeze, "lib/rtanque.rb".freeze, "lib/rtanque/arena.rb".freeze, "lib/rtanque/bot.rb".freeze, "lib/rtanque/bot/brain.rb".freeze, "lib/rtanque/bot/brain_helper.rb".freeze, "lib/rtanque/bot/command.rb".freeze, "lib/rtanque/bot/radar.rb".freeze, "lib/rtanque/bot/sensors.rb".freeze, "lib/rtanque/bot/turret.rb".freeze, "lib/rtanque/configuration.rb".freeze, "lib/rtanque/explosion.rb".freeze, "lib/rtanque/gui.rb".freeze, "lib/rtanque/gui/bot.rb".freeze, "lib/rtanque/gui/bot/health_color_calculator.rb".freeze, "lib/rtanque/gui/draw_group.rb".freeze, "lib/rtanque/gui/explosion.rb".freeze, "lib/rtanque/gui/shell.rb".freeze, "lib/rtanque/gui/window.rb".freeze, "lib/rtanque/heading.rb".freeze, "lib/rtanque/match.rb".freeze, "lib/rtanque/match/tick_group.rb".freeze, "lib/rtanque/movable.rb".freeze, "lib/rtanque/normalized_attr.rb".freeze, "lib/rtanque/point.rb".freeze, "lib/rtanque/runner.rb".freeze, "lib/rtanque/shell.rb".freeze, "lib/rtanque/version.rb".freeze, "resources/images/body.png".freeze, "resources/images/bullet.png".freeze, "resources/images/explosions/explosion2-1.png".freeze, "resources/images/explosions/explosion2-10.png".freeze, "resources/images/explosions/explosion2-11.png".freeze, "resources/images/explosions/explosion2-12.png".freeze, "resources/images/explosions/explosion2-13.png".freeze, "resources/images/explosions/explosion2-14.png".freeze, "resources/images/explosions/explosion2-15.png".freeze, "resources/images/explosions/explosion2-16.png".freeze, "resources/images/explosions/explosion2-17.png".freeze, "resources/images/explosions/explosion2-18.png".freeze, "resources/images/explosions/explosion2-19.png".freeze, "resources/images/explosions/explosion2-2.png".freeze, "resources/images/explosions/explosion2-20.png".freeze, "resources/images/explosions/explosion2-21.png".freeze, "resources/images/explosions/explosion2-22.png".freeze, "resources/images/explosions/explosion2-23.png".freeze, "resources/images/explosions/explosion2-24.png".freeze, "resources/images/explosions/explosion2-25.png".freeze, "resources/images/explosions/explosion2-26.png".freeze, "resources/images/explosions/explosion2-27.png".freeze, "resources/images/explosions/explosion2-28.png".freeze, "resources/images/explosions/explosion2-29.png".freeze, "resources/images/explosions/explosion2-3.png".freeze, "resources/images/explosions/explosion2-30.png".freeze, "resources/images/explosions/explosion2-31.png".freeze, "resources/images/explosions/explosion2-32.png".freeze, "resources/images/explosions/explosion2-33.png".freeze, "resources/images/explosions/explosion2-34.png".freeze, "resources/images/explosions/explosion2-35.png".freeze, "resources/images/explosions/explosion2-36.png".freeze, "resources/images/explosions/explosion2-37.png".freeze, "resources/images/explosions/explosion2-38.png".freeze, "resources/images/explosions/explosion2-39.png".freeze, "resources/images/explosions/explosion2-4.png".freeze, "resources/images/explosions/explosion2-40.png".freeze, "resources/images/explosions/explosion2-41.png".freeze, "resources/images/explosions/explosion2-42.png".freeze, "resources/images/explosions/explosion2-43.png".freeze, "resources/images/explosions/explosion2-44.png".freeze, "resources/images/explosions/explosion2-45.png".freeze, "resources/images/explosions/explosion2-46.png".freeze, "resources/images/explosions/explosion2-47.png".freeze, "resources/images/explosions/explosion2-48.png".freeze, "resources/images/explosions/explosion2-49.png".freeze, "resources/images/explosions/explosion2-5.png".freeze, "resources/images/explosions/explosion2-50.png".freeze, "resources/images/explosions/explosion2-51.png".freeze, "resources/images/explosions/explosion2-52.png".freeze, "resources/images/explosions/explosion2-53.png".freeze, "resources/images/explosions/explosion2-54.png".freeze, "resources/images/explosions/explosion2-55.png".freeze, "resources/images/explosions/explosion2-56.png".freeze, "resources/images/explosions/explosion2-57.png".freeze, "resources/images/explosions/explosion2-58.png".freeze, "resources/images/explosions/explosion2-59.png".freeze, "resources/images/explosions/explosion2-6.png".freeze, "resources/images/explosions/explosion2-60.png".freeze, "resources/images/explosions/explosion2-61.png".freeze, "resources/images/explosions/explosion2-62.png".freeze, "resources/images/explosions/explosion2-63.png".freeze, "resources/images/explosions/explosion2-64.png".freeze, "resources/images/explosions/explosion2-65.png".freeze, "resources/images/explosions/explosion2-66.png".freeze, "resources/images/explosions/explosion2-67.png".freeze, "resources/images/explosions/explosion2-68.png".freeze, "resources/images/explosions/explosion2-69.png".freeze, "resources/images/explosions/explosion2-7.png".freeze, "resources/images/explosions/explosion2-70.png".freeze, "resources/images/explosions/explosion2-71.png".freeze, "resources/images/explosions/explosion2-8.png".freeze, "resources/images/explosions/explosion2-9.png".freeze, "resources/images/grass.png".freeze, "resources/images/radar.png".freeze, "resources/images/turret.png".freeze, "rtanque.gemspec".freeze, "sample_bots/camper.rb".freeze, "sample_bots/keyboard.rb".freeze, "sample_bots/seek_and_destroy.rb".freeze, "screenshots/battle_1.png".freeze, "screenshots/battle_2.png".freeze, "spec/rtanque/bot_spec.rb".freeze, "spec/rtanque/heading_spec.rb".freeze, "spec/rtanque/match_spec.rb".freeze, "spec/rtanque/normalized_attr_spec.rb".freeze, "spec/rtanque/point_spec.rb".freeze, "spec/rtanque/radar_spec.rb".freeze, "spec/rtanque/shell_spec.rb".freeze, "spec/rtanque_spec.rb".freeze, "spec/spec_helper.rb".freeze, "templates/bot.erb".freeze] s.homepage = "https://github.com/awilliams/RTanque".freeze s.licenses = ["MIT".freeze] s.rubygems_version = "3.5.10".freeze s.summary = "RTanque is a game for programmers. Players program the brain of a tank and then send their tank into battle against other tanks.".freeze s.test_files = ["spec/rtanque/bot_spec.rb".freeze, "spec/rtanque/heading_spec.rb".freeze, "spec/rtanque/match_spec.rb".freeze, "spec/rtanque/normalized_attr_spec.rb".freeze, "spec/rtanque/point_spec.rb".freeze, "spec/rtanque/radar_spec.rb".freeze, "spec/rtanque/shell_spec.rb".freeze, "spec/rtanque_spec.rb".freeze, "spec/spec_helper.rb".freeze] s.specification_version = 4 s.add_runtime_dependency(%q.freeze, ["~> 0.7.45".freeze]) s.add_runtime_dependency(%q.freeze, ["~> 1.3.2".freeze]) s.add_runtime_dependency(%q.freeze, ["~> 2.7.0".freeze]) s.add_runtime_dependency(%q.freeze, ["~> 0.17.0".freeze]) s.add_runtime_dependency(%q.freeze, [">= 0".freeze]) s.add_development_dependency(%q.freeze, [">= 0".freeze]) s.add_development_dependency(%q.freeze, ["~> 2.13.0".freeze]) s.add_development_dependency(%q.freeze, ["~> 2.13.0".freeze]) end